Importance of Preambles
1. Contextual Understanding: Preambles offer a glimpse into the historical, social, and political context surrounding the creation of legal documents, aiding in their interpretation.
2. Clarity of Purpose: A well-crafted preamble succinctly articulates the objectives and intentions behind the document, guiding readers towards a clear understanding of its purpose.
3. Legal Interpretation: Courts often refer to preambles when interpreting ambiguous provisions, underscoring their significance in legal analysis and decision-making.
Elements of an Effective Preamble
1. Statement of Intent: Clearly state the goals and objectives that the document seeks to achieve, providing a roadmap for its implementation.
2. Historical Background: Provide context by outlining the historical events or circumstances that prompted the creation of the document.
3. Values and Principles: Express the underlying values, principles, and ideals that underpin the document's content and objectives.
